Evaluation of Toxicities in Patients Treated With Palliative Radiotherapy at Policlinico Sant Orsola of Bologna.
NCT06760806 · Status: RECRUITING · Type: OBSERVATIONAL · Enrollment: 7000
Last updated 2025-01-07
Summary
The aim of the study is to assess the outcome in palliative patients, particularly in terms of symptom resolution or alleviation, after radiation treatment of the various tumours analysed, in relation to the treatment setting, dosages and techniques used both for newly diagnosed tumours and for cases already diagnosed and treated at the Radiotherapy Unit of the Sant Orsola Hospital.
